Tooth extractions are a common procedure, and it is important to follow the dentist’s aftercare instructions properly to ensure proper healing. After the extraction, it is important to avoid drinking through a straw, smoking, brushing too harshly, or rinsing your mouth too vigorously for 24–48 hours. ...

WebJan 9, 2024 · If your child wants help removing a loose tooth, the AAP offers the following tip: Grasp the tooth with a clean tissue or gauze and give it a quick twist. When pulling a tooth at home, the ADA reminds parents to be gentle. A tooth that is sufficiently loose will fall out with just a gentle squeeze. If your child doesn't want help, don't try to ...
